What is the best type of oil to use in a Ford Focus?

I recently purchased a Ford Focus and I'm not sure what type of oil is best for my car. Can someone advise me on which type of oil to use and how often to change it?

I recommend using synthetic oil for your Ford Focus as it offers better engine protection and performance. It's also important to check your oil level regularly and change it every 5,000-7,500 miles.

You should also consider the climate in your area when choosing oil for your Ford Focus. Thicker oil is better for colder temperatures while thinner oil is best for hotter climates.

I've been using high mileage oil in my Ford Focus and have had great results. It's formulated for older, higher mileage cars and can help prolong engine life.
